The Talented 20 Program Class of 2006–Logon ID (Identification)
Florida continues to focus on maximizing student achievement and student access to
postsecondary education opportunities. In order to facilitate the evaluation of high school
transcripts for the Talented 20 program, we plan to add a Talented 20 program link to the Florida
Department of Education’s (FDOE) website in January 2006.
This program link will provide high school counselors and other identified educators with the
opportunity to view district and school student eligibility data online. In the past student
eligibility reports were available at the Northwest Regional Data Center (NWRDC) for districts
to download the day after the data were submitted. Beginning with the identification of the top
20% of the graduating class of 2006 for the Talented 20 program, district-identified educators
will download student eligibility reports online from the new program link located on the FDOE
website.
To view district or high school student eligibility data, educators will have an established
Talented 20 Program Logon ID. The logon ID will be separate from the Bright Futures Logon
ID, yet similar in format.
